Art Of Quarantine: 9 Classical Art Posters Adjusted To Quarantine

According to Looma, a creative production agency from Kiev, Ukraine: “During the current coronavirus pandemic, many people still ignore the basic rules of quarantine and personal security.

We can say that the ability to preserve the quarantine is a kind of art. This is how Looma agency came up with the idea of “Art of Quarantine” social campaign. Classic art pieces get a new look and teach how to stop the spread of COVID-19 and stay safe.

As a part of global campaign #FlattenTheCurve, we aim to share this message and stop the spread of the virus.

Stay home, stay healthy!”
